Output dd18a5f5450998cf497fe286a27b7f4af56d700feba86e6d2482b85028196ea9:17

value
790110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99dbd7a12ef6e112666aa15c3550a261ce23ff54 OP_EQUAL
address
3FiYfodgBy2bLTeRvLPu89oqr29wVezQp8
transaction
dd18a5f5450998cf497fe286a27b7f4af56d700feba86e6d2482b85028196ea9
spent
true